Transaction 7a705bc39a7590f593c4afb5967c90599804ecf1d3bbb01e6a4525245aa096b3

2 Input
2 Outputs
  • 7a705bc39a7590f593c4afb5967c90599804ecf1d3bbb01e6a4525245aa096b3:0
  • value  6467734
    address  19DLuJtqtkmRocJnZzxLzKqdThsdsCos9Z
  • 7a705bc39a7590f593c4afb5967c90599804ecf1d3bbb01e6a4525245aa096b3:1
  • value  100000000
    address  1668C54QqF3reE9sbuCUPLzMVibMWvP5Ub